Here is a soulful mid-week treat. Henry Aberson, a songwriter and music producer, has already been featured on this website last year. And now it’s time for his latest delivery, “Call” with Derran Day on the vocals.
With its soft, RnB arrangement, “Call” occupies the space of complete relaxation, feeling both romantic and sensual. A bit nightly, or eveningly, and definitely cozy. The vocals of Derran Day, an RnB and soul vocalist, known for his warm baritone and gospel-rooted phrasing, are at the center of this soothing love story. A story so intimate, the listener feels almost like an “intruder” looking in. In the positive sense of this comparison, of course, full of loving warmth and physical passion.
The collaboration between Henry Aberson and Derran Day feels quite natural from start to finish. The vocal and instrumental elements complement each other in a slow, soulful dance of talents, bringing their best to the surface. It’s this quest for musical perfection, a reflection of a hands-on approach to production, that makes “Call” shine. Rooted in the vintage RnB sound, and somehow suspended between the different musical eras, results in something timeless. Something that escapes an easy classification, yet remains calmingly familiar and relatable at the same time.
